
Angkor Resources Corp faces a significant drop in stock price as investor sentiment shifts.
Angkor Resources Corp (ANK.V) is experiencing a sharp decline, with shares falling by 7.14% today, closing at CA$0.26. This downturn comes despite recent advancements in exploration efforts in Cambodia, raising questions about investor confidence.

Bull case
The completion of the first onshore seismic program in Cambodia could point to potential hydrocarbon traps. If the exploration yields positive results, it may lead to future growth for the company.
Bear case
The significant drop in stock price suggests that investors may be losing faith in Angkor's ability to deliver on its exploration promises, especially after ending agreements with CanBodia Copper Corp.
Current Market Performance
Angkor Resources Corp’s stock is down 7.14% today, closing at CA$0.26. This decline raises concerns about the company’s ability to maintain investor confidence amidst ongoing exploration activities.
Recent Developments
Despite the stock's poor performance, Angkor has made strides in its exploration efforts, including completing a seismic survey in Cambodia. However, the termination of its agreement with CanBodia Copper Corp may have contributed to today's stock drop.
